Advances in Multi-Scale Analysis of Brain Complexity
In neuroscience, a defining but elusive question regarding the human brain is its astonishingly
structural and functional complexity. This complexity arises from the interaction of numerous
neuronal circuits that operate over a wide range of temporal and spatial scales, enabling the
brain to adapt to the constantly changing environment and to perform various high-level mental
functions. Such dynamical and functional adaptability is often reduced during the aging process
and considerably impaired in patients with neuropsychiatric diseases, leading to rigid, fixed, or
on the opposite, unpredictable behaviors
